What is One?
One is an agent infrastructure platform that connects AI agents to 500+ applications. It provides managed authentication, action knowledge, execution, permissions, event triggers, monitoring, APIs, MCP, and a CLI for production agent workflows.

Limitations
One cannot guarantee that an agent chooses the correct action or that a connected API behaves as expected. Teams must restrict permissions, test workflows, protect data, monitor logs and budgets, and require approval for sensitive or irreversible actions.

Pricing note
Free includes unlimited connections, MCP and CLI, and one million API calls. Starter costs $29 per month and Pro $199. Overage rates vary by tier, agents cost $40 each on public plans, and Enterprise pricing is custom.
